Does anyone have suggestions on how I can stay on top of forum posts that I want to reply to. Here's some things i do but i'm looking for a better way:

1) view latest posts- http://www.metopen.com/fsearch-newposts.html This works well for me but I dont always have time to reply right away- the next time i look at messages this message wont show up.
2) bookmark- but then it doesn't pass across machines

All I do is simply make one reply to each thread so I am automatically notified by email of replies.
If the notification contains a new post I want to reply to but do not have time at that precise moment, I just flag it in my email client to remind me to revisit it again.

Obviously this only works if you have already made a post in the thread and your default profile has reply notification turned on.

My signature usually has something like "Pushed for time right now but intend to reply soon to this" so entering the thread is simply a case of hitting reply with signature turned on.
